Human Cord Blood and Bone Marrow CD34+ Cells Generate Macrophages That Support Erythroid Islands
Recently, we developed a small molecule responsive hyperactive Mpl-based Cell Growth Switch (CGS) that drives erythropoiesis associated with macrophages in the absence of exogenous cytokines.
